Contracts Manager – Commercial Projects
Location: Ipswich
Salary: £70-£80k
Employment Type: Full-time, Permanent
About the Role
We are seeking a highly experienced Contracts Manager to oversee the delivery of high-value commercial construction projects. This role offers the opportunity to lead a dynamic project team, drive operational excellence, and ensure the successful, safe, and timely completion of complex builds. You will act as the main point of contact for clients and be responsible for maintaining strong relationships with all st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and inspire a project delivery team, providing guidance, mentoring, and support to junior staff.
Serve as the primary client interface, ensuring exceptional service and communication throughout the project lifecycle.
Develop, implement, and monitor project programmes, managing timelines, resources, and risks effectively.
Oversee budget management, including cost control, variation approvals, and financial reporting.
Ensure high-quality standards are maintained across all works, with rigorous adherence to drawings, specifications, and quality plans.
Establish and enforce robust Health & Safety procedures, ensuring compliance with current legislation and site plans.
Prepare accurate, timely project reports and updates for senior management and directors.
Support the Pre-Contract team by contributing to bids and helping secure future commercial opportunities.
Maintain an awareness of industry developments, new regulations, and emerging best practices, adapting processes as necessary.
What We’re Looking For
Proven leadership skills with the ability to motivate teams and foster a positive, results-driven culture.
Excellent verbal and written communication, with experience building strong relationships with clients, subcontractors, and internal teams.
Highly self-motivated with a practical, solution-focused approach to challenges.
Strong project management experience, particularly in commercial construction projects, meeting tight deadlines without compromising quality.
Proficient in construction management software (ASTA experience is advantageous).
Commercially astute, with a clear understanding of budgeting, cost control, and risk management.
Solid knowledge of Health & Safety legislation and the ability to implement compliant site procedures.
Eligible to work in the UK with a full driving licence.
